Default Fuel system questions

Ok guys I need some help for my winter build. I have about 90% of my build figured out. What I need help with is the fuel system.

I going to run a 5.3L block with a Logan intake and stage 3 N/A cams from MHS. I plan on turning 7k RPM and I'm hoping to see between 360 & 380 HP to the tires.

I'm thinking either 39# or 42# injectors. I would hate to go with 30#ers and be pushing the duty cycle on them. What I have no clue on is what I should use for a fuel pump.

Anyone have any suggestions ?

Default Re: Fuel system questions

you should be fine with 39# injectors, 30# would be pushing the limit on their duty cycle (93% assuming 380rwhp). You should Try to get as small of injector as you can so you can more easily tune at idle and low rpm.

You should be at about 85% duty cycle to be safe. So with stock fuel pressure of ~39psi you'll need ~33lb injectors.

a 255lph walbro should do the trick for you too

what is a ppv delete ?? does the stryker fit right into the old spot ?

The pprv is a delete u do in order to free up duty cycle cause its a major fuel restriction, all u gotta do is, when u pull ur housing out ul c 2 accordin style house and a small housing on top wit 2 tiny screws, ur gonna take them off and throw them right out, then ur gonna buy 1ft of gates 5/16 submerseable fuel line (no other lines will work, the gas will eat it ) ur gonna hook that hose straight from pump to ur fuel hat, makeing sure ot dosent kink, i used a brass elbow were it bends so i know it wont kink but u can also use a nylon elbow, but be4 that ur also gotta drill about 4-5 5/16 holes in bottom of basket
